CicLAvia - Culver City Meets Mar Vista and Palms
CicLAvia returns to the West Side, with a 6.5 mile route that connects Culver City to Mar Vista and Palms.
The route allows participants to explore more of Culver City’s charming neighborhoods, eclectic businesses and delicious restaurants. This is the first time CicLAvia is highlighting Palms.
Event hubs are at the Arts District Culver City, Downtown Culver City, Palms, Washington West and Mar Vista. The interactive map details activities along the route, as well as restaurants, landmarks and such.
CicLAvia is derived from a Spanish term for "bike path," and its goal is to turn LA into one big bike path, if just for a few hours. People are encouraged to leave their cars at home and bike, walk, skateboard, or push a stroller to discover our beautiful city at non-motorized speeds. CicLAvia offers a wide variety of activities for people of all interests and ages, including music, performances, food trucks galore, and more.
